Hippeastrum breeding began in 1799 when Arthur Johnson, a watchmaker in Prescot, England, crossed Hippeastrum reginae with Hippeastrum vitattum, obtaining hybrids that were later given the name Hippeastrum × 'Johnsonii' (Johnson's amaryllis, 'hardy amaryllis' or St. Joseph's lily). Some gardeners even manage to grow amaryllis in zone 8 or 7b, but if so, plant the bulb more deeply, with up to 3 inches (8 cm) of soil covering it, and mulch it heavily in the autumn as well, as you’ll want to keep the bulb frost-free. Planting Time: Avoid planting in extreme heat or cold Shipping Period: March 15- September 15 Bloom Type: Red and white striped Bloom Period: Late Spring Bloom Size: Softball Sized Zones: 7-10 Color: Red w/White Stripes Planting Depth: Plant w/ neck just above soil Soil: Any / not standing water Fragrance: Excellent Light: Full Sun to Part Shade Height: 10"-24" A hardy amaryllis clump usually measures 18 to 24 inches tall—with flower stems typically topping out at the 2-foot mark.
